Contemporary Literature in Close Up.

In 'Vintage Living Texts' teachers and students will find the essential guide to the works of Sebastian Faulks, author of 'Birdsong', 'Charlotte Gray', and 'The Girl At The Lion D'or'.

This guide deals with Faulks's themes, genre and narrative technique, and a close reading of the texts is accompanied with likely exam questions - as well as providing a rich source of ideas for intelligent and inventive ways of approaching the novels.

Also included are detailed reading plans for all three novels, questions for essays and discussion, contextual material, suggested texts for complementary and comparative reading, a picture essay, extracts from reviews, a biography, a bibliography, a reading list of literary criticism and a glossary of literary terms.

Whether a teacher, student or general reader, 'Vintage Living Texts' gives you the chance to explore new resources and enjoy new pleasures.
